-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:SQLiteOpenHelperの実行タイミングは)
SQLiteOpenHelperの実行タイミングとは?
このQ&Aのポイント
- 「SQLiteOpenHelperクラス」を継承したユーザー定義クラスの、「コンストラクタ」や「onCreateメソッド」はデータベースの作成や開閉を行うタイミングで呼び出されます。
- アクティビティにアクセスした時点で読み込まれるわけではなく、継承元のSQLiteOpenHelperクラスのインスタンス作成時に呼び出されます。
- コンストラクタの引数として渡っているContextは、データベースの保存先やアクセス権限を指定するために使用されます。
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
>どのタイミングで、どこから呼び出されるか これは誰にもわかりません。 では、 >・どうやってそれを知るのでしょうか? 両方からアクセスできるデータベーステーブルをつくり、 「終わったらフラグを立てるよ。」という作業をしてもらいます。 こちらはそのフラグが立つまで待っていればいいのです。
お礼
回答ありがとうございましたー